Semiconductor components shape our everyday lives, powering the chips in every computer and electronic device we use – from mobile phones to medical devices to safety features in cars.  
 
Building these components is therefore incredibly precise work, requiring significant knowledge and skill to prevent anything going wrong. We source experts in this area for various developers working on everything from MedTech to energy development. One example of where we’ve made an impact is with a client reworking a temperature-measuring camera used in crystal production for wafers — essential components in semiconductor manufacturing. A single defective batch can result in losses worth six to eight figures.  
 
By improving the accuracy of temperature measurement, the project enhances production efficiency and ensures the reliability of semiconductor materials.
